Wilson has a population of 449 with a median age of 32.7. Here is the racial and ethnic breakdown of the population:
| Demographic | Value |
|---|---|
| Total Population | 449 |
| Median Age | 32.7 |
| White | 37.4% |
| Black or African American | 0.2% |
| Hispanic or Latino | 69.9% |
The median household income in Wilson is $50,500, which is 37.4% below the national median of $80,610. The per capita income is $26,952. The poverty rate is 34.7%.

In Wilson, 86.4% of residents age 25+ have a high school diploma or higher, and 23.0% hold a bachelor's degree or higher (4.7% with a graduate or professional degree).
| Education Level | % of Adults (25+) |
|---|---|
| High School Diploma or Higher | 86.4% |
| Bachelor's Degree or Higher | 23.0% |
| Graduate or Professional Degree | 4.7% |
The median home value in Wilson is $131,800, below the national median of $303,400. The median monthly rent is $925. The homeownership rate is 77.4%.
| Housing Metric | Value |
|---|---|
| Median Home Value | $131,800 |
| Median Monthly Rent | $925 |
| Homeownership Rate | 77.4% |
| Vacancy Rate | 11.0% |
